    int eth_mii_get_phy_id(const char *ifname, int port, int *phy_id)
    
    {
    	struct mii_ioctl_data *mii;
    	struct ifreq ifr;
    	int s;
    
    	s = socket(AF_INET, SOCK_DGRAM, 0);
    	if (s < 0)
    		return -1;
    
    	memset(&ifr, 0, sizeof(struct ifreq));
    	strncpy(ifr.ifr_name, ifname, IFNAMSIZ);
    	if (ioctl(s, SIOCGIFINDEX, &ifr) < 0) {
    
    		libethernet_err("SIOCGIFINDEX failed!\n");
    
    		close(s);
    		return -1;
    	}
    
    	mii = if_mii(&ifr);
    	memset(mii, 0, sizeof(struct mii_ioctl_data));
    
    	mii->val_in = (uint16_t)port;
    
    
    	if (ioctl(s, SIOCGMIIPHY, &ifr) < 0) {
    
    		libethernet_err("SIOCGMIIPHY failed!\n");
    
    		close(s);
    		return -1;
    	}
    
    	if (phy_id)
    		*phy_id = mii->phy_id;
    
    
    	//libethernet_dbg("%s: phy_id = %d\n", ifname, *phy_id);
    
    static int eth_mii_ioctl(const char *ifname, int cmd, int phy_id, int reg,
    
    						int in, int *out)
    {
    	struct mii_ioctl_data *mii;
    	struct ifreq ifr;
    	int s;
    
    	s = socket(AF_INET, SOCK_DGRAM, 0);
    	if (s < 0)
    		return -1;
    
    	memset(&ifr, 0, sizeof(struct ifreq));
    
    	strncpy(ifr.ifr_name, ifname, IFNAMSIZ);
    
    	if (ioctl(s, SIOCGIFINDEX, &ifr) < 0) {
    
    		libethernet_err("SIOCGIFINDEX failed!\n");
    
    		close(s);
    		return -1;
    	}
    
    	mii = if_mii(&ifr);
    	memset(mii, 0, sizeof(struct mii_ioctl_data));
    
    	//PHYID_2_MII_IOCTL(phy_id, mii);
    
    	mii->phy_id = (uint16_t)phy_id;
    	mii->reg_num = (uint16_t)reg;
    	mii->val_in = (uint16_t)in;
    
    
    	if (ioctl(s, cmd, &ifr) < 0) {
    
    		libethernet_err("MII cmd on %s failed\n", ifr.ifr_name);
    
    		close(s);
    		return -1;
    	}
    
    	if (out)
    		*out = mii->val_out;	// FIXME?
    
    	close(s);
    	return 0;
    }
